Toulouse Targets Simelane

Photo Credit: Speedshots.co.za

French side Toulouse has approached the Lions for permission to start negotiations with Wandisile Simelane.

According to a report in City Press, the Lions received an email this week from Toulouse requesting permission to speak to Simelane. Apparently, a Lions insider claimed there is a clause in Simelane’s contract which states that if an offer comes in from an overseas club, then the Lions has to consider it.

Simelane only recently signed a two-year contract extension with the Lions back in May, after being linked with moves to the Stormers and Sharks.

In a response to inquiries about the potential move, Lions CEO Straeuli outlined the franchise’s desire to keep one of their brightest young players.

‘Wandi has a two-year contract. He’s not going anywhere,’ Straeuli told City Press. I got an email, but he’s in our and the Boks’ long-term plans.’
